Allegations of misconduct, immoral activities and defamatory statements against Mridula Biswas, the nursing supervisor of Goalanda Upazila Health Complex in Rajbari. Out of 43 nurses working in the hospital, 29 nurses have filed written complaints to the higher authorities regarding this. There is currently intense anger and dissatisfaction among the nurses and aides working in the hospital.
It is alleged that the nursing supervisor of the hospital, Mrs. Mridula Biswas, has arbitrarily and secretly performed MR and D&C in the absence of a gynecologist at various times and has taken financial benefits, putting the patient’s life at risk. In addition, she has taken financial benefits by showing extra food outside the hospital to patients who have been admitted to the hospital for a long time. Later, she covered it up by exerting political influence.

Mridula Biswas, nursing supervisor of A Goalanda Upazila Health Complex, said on the phone that there are many nurses in the hospital who have to be seen. There may be tension with them over duty, but no one is mistreated. He denied the allegations of DMC and other issues in the OTT room.
District Civil Surgeon Dr. SM Masud said on the phone that he has received the investigation report and has sent the matter to the DGF in Dhaka and the higher authorities. Moreover, he said that they do not control transfers or punishments.
